Darren Aronofsky’s Requiem for a Dream (2000) remains one of the most visually stunning, emotionally shattering, and psychologically intense films in cinema history. Adapted from the 1978 novel by Hubert Selby Jr., this psychological drama explores the devastating impact of addiction on four individuals living in Coney Island, Brooklyn. index of requiem for a dream exclusive

Aronofsky utilized split-screens, extreme close-ups (hip-hop montages), and time-lapse photography to mimic the psychological state of drug dependency.
Released in 2000, Requiem for a Dream remains a monumental piece of cinema. Directed by Darren Aronofsky and based on the 1978 novel by Hubert Selby Jr., the film tracks the severe emotional and physical degradation of four individuals trapped in substance addiction.
